Aerospace Fighter v1.0 (TL 09) Copyright 1996 by Onno Meyer This fighter spacecraft was build to escort Space Marine troop craft down onto planetary surfaces and to support the Marines there. The fighter has two hardpoints and two pairs of twin linked particle guns (crit|imp|6d*20|10|20|1.5 mi.|3 mi.|2*3|10 KWh) under the nose and on the back (they share one targeting system). The power cells give 200 shots (each hour of ladar or jammer use uses one shot). The air lasts for only 3 days and the reaction mass for a mere 40 minutes, but on full thrust the fighter pulls 4 or more Gs. Sensors are thermographs (with 27 miles nominal range), a ladar (30 miles) and multiscanners (5 miles). The cockpit section with most electronics is detachable for easy maintenance. The fighter is a TL09 Vehicle [July 96 errata sheet]. Structure: 400 cf advanced XH body (HT 1,200), max. load 18 tons, superior streamlining, sealed body, three retractable wheels (DR 2, HT 67/134), two combat-stressed wings with canards (HT 600), vertol lift and advanced controls. Propulsion: Twin 24t fusion rockets (DR 5, HT 100) with water for 40.44 minutes in two 250-gallon wing tanks and a 600-gallon tank (self- sealing, DR 5, HT 125). Power: 2 MWh rechargeable power cells (DR 5, HT 12). Accomodations: One normal seat, few armored windows (DR 75). Crew Requirements: Pilot. Armor: 450 points advanced armor, F6/75 B6/50 R6/50 L6/50 T6/50 U6/75 RW6/50 LW6/50. Cargo: None, but 7.9 cf waste space. Accessories: Six chaff or flare dischargers, ejection seat, compact fire extinguisher, G-seat, improved IR cloaking, laser sensors, 3 man-days limited lifesystem, medium deceptive and area jammers (jam 10, DR 3, HT 10, electronics), rad shielding, radical stealth, two advanced long- range thermographs (scan 23, DR 3, HT 10, electronics), medium ladar with rangefinder (scan 22, DR 3, HT 10, electronics), two medium multiscanners (scan 16, DR 3, HT 6, electronics), HUDWAC with pupil scanner and virtual panorama, three optical genius minicomputers (C5, DR 3, HT 4, electronics), modular design (2 units), two INS (DR 3, HT 6, electronics), two GPS, two secure long-distance radios (DR 3, HT 4, electronics), two IFF, two terrain-following radars, two lasercoms. Programs: Database (946.62 GB maps and recognition guides), datalink, sensor operation (C5, skill 17 or +6), gunner (C5, skill 14 or +4), tactical vehicle operation (C4, skill 15), targeting (C5, +7). Weaponry: Two pairs of twin autostabilized, linked gatling C-PAWS (DR 5, HT 20) in open mounts and two hardpoints. Statistics: Cost $16,000,000, design mass 11.8 tons, maximum payload 6.2 tons, max. hardpoint load 6.2 tons, current payload 0.2 tons, loaded mass 12 tons, size modifier +4, radar signature -5 (-15 or -25 if jamming), IR signature +6, acoustic signature +7. Ground Performance: N/A. Water Performance: None. Air Performance: Speed factor 112, top speed 1,764 mph, acceleration 31.5 mph/s, deceleration 10 mph/s, MR 14, SR 6, ceiling unlimited. Space Performance: Acceleration between 4 and 7.08 G, delta-V 125 km/s.
